Egelabra is one of the major parent studs in Australia with 10,000 stud breeding ewes bred on three properties around Warren in central New South Wales.

Egelabra is proud to boast an average lambing percentage of 99% (average taken between 1990 to 2002).

Merino ewes are the fundamental building block of the Australian wool and sheep meat industries and their true value is reflected in strong sales in saleyards across the country. Egelabra ewes consistently achieve above average prices and are considered a reliable investment. Their renowned trueness to type and easy care are in constant demand.

The Egelabra ewe is now becoming recognised as the Merino ewe bloodline of choice by first cross and prime lamb producers. This is due to a hidden trait that produces progeny with superior carcase characteristics.

Breeding Policy:

The breeding policy at Egelabra is to maintain the bloodline as a pure genetic strain. This allows for consistent quality and a targeted and true breeding program. Egelabra sheep have been classed and bred with the aid of objective measurement to produce a longer bodied, more densely covered, long stapled sheep with the special type of pearly, white, soft wool unique to the bloodline.
